华氏0℉~300℉,每隔20℉输出一个华氏温度对应的摄氏温度值。
时间: 2023-04-25 19:03:11 浏览: 190
华氏0℉~300℉,每隔20℉输出一个华氏温度对应的摄氏温度值。
华氏0℉对应的摄氏温度为-17.8℃;
华氏20℉对应的摄氏温度为-6.7℃;
华氏40℉对应的摄氏温度为4.4℃;
华氏60℉对应的摄氏温度为15.6℃;
华氏80℉对应的摄氏温度为26.7℃;
华氏100℉对应的摄氏温度为37.8℃;
华氏120℉对应的摄氏温度为48.9℃;
华氏140℉对应的摄氏温度为60℃;
华氏160℉对应的摄氏温度为71.1℃;
华氏180℉对应的摄氏温度为82.2℃;
华氏200℉对应的摄氏温度为93.3℃;
华氏220℉对应的摄氏温度为104.4℃;
华氏240℉对应的摄氏温度为115.6℃;
华氏260℉对应的摄氏温度为126.7℃;
华氏280℉对应的摄氏温度为137.8℃;
华氏300℉对应的摄氏温度为148.9℃。
相关问题
c语言编程要求:华氏0℉~300℉,每隔20℉输出一个华氏温度对应的摄氏温度值。
好的,这个问题是关于C语言编程的,可以回答。根据华氏与摄氏温度转换公式C=(5/9)*(F-32),我们可以使用循环语句输出0℉~300℉,每隔20℉输出一个对应的摄氏温度值。具体代码如下:
```c
#include <stdio.h>
int main() {
float fahr, celsius;
int lower, upper, step;
lower = 0; // 温度表的下限
upper = 300; // 温度表的上限
step = 20; // 步长
fahr = lower;
while (fahr <= upper) {
celsius = (5.0 / 9.0) * (fahr - 32.0);
printf("%.0f\t%.1f\n", fahr, celsius);
fahr += step;
}
return 0;
}
```
输出结果如下:
```
0 -17.8
20 -6.7
40 4.4
60 15.6
80 26.7
100 37.8
120 48.9
140 60.0
160 71.1
180 82.2
200 93.3
220 104.4
240 115.6
260 126.7
280 137.8
300 148.9
```
华氏和摄氏温度的转换公式为: c = 5/9 x (f-32) 其中,c表示摄氏温度,f表示华氏温度。 要求:华氏0℉~300℉,每隔20℉输出一个华氏温度对应的摄氏温度值。
### 回答1:
根据转换公式 c = 5/9 x (f-32),我们可以将华氏温度转换成摄氏温度。要求输出华氏0℉~300℉范围内,每隔20℉输出一个华氏温度对应的摄氏温度值,我们可以按照以下步骤进行计算:
1. 将华氏温度从0℉开始,每隔20℉递增,直到300℉。
2. 对于每个华氏温度值,使用转换公式 c = 5/9 x (f-32) 计算对应的摄氏温度值。
3. 输出每个华氏温度值以及其对应的摄氏温度值。
根据上述步骤,我们可以得到如下的输出结果:
华氏温度0℉对应的摄氏温度为-17.78℃
华氏温度20℉对应的摄氏温度为-6.67℃
华氏温度40℉对应的摄氏温度为4.44℃
华氏温度60℉对应的摄氏温度为15.56℃
华氏温度80℉对应的摄氏温度为26.67℃
华氏温度100℉对应的摄氏温度为37.78℃
华氏温度120℉对应的摄氏温度为48.89℃
华氏温度140℉对应的摄氏温度为60.00℃
华氏温度160℉对应的摄氏温度为71.11℃
华氏温度180℉对应的摄氏温度为82.22℃
华氏温度200℉对应的摄氏温度为93.33℃
华氏温度220℉对应的摄氏温度为104.44℃
华氏温度240℉对应的摄氏温度为115.56℃
华氏温度260℉对应的摄氏温度为126.67℃
华氏温度280℉对应的摄氏温度为137.78℃
华氏温度300℉对应的摄氏温度为148.89℃
### 回答2:
华氏温度和摄氏温度是世界上两种常用的温度单位。在物理学和工程学领域,这两种温度单位都具有重要的应用。在日常生活中,比如用温度计来测量气温等,也经常会遇到华氏温度和摄氏温度的转换问题。
华氏和摄氏温度的转换公式为:c = 5/9 x (f-32)。其中c表示摄氏温度,f表示华氏温度。要求在华氏0℉~300℉的范围内,每隔20℉输出一个华氏温度对应的摄氏温度值。
按照转换公式,我们可以先求出0℉对应的摄氏温度:
c = 5/9 x (0-32) = -17.78℃
然后,每隔20℉就代入转换公式计算出对应的摄氏温度,直到到达300℉为止。计算结果如下表:
华氏温度 | 摄氏温度
0℉ | -17.78℃
20℉ | -6.67℃
40℉ | 4.44℃
60℉ | 15.56℃
80℉ | 26.67℃
100℉ | 37.78℃
120℉ | 48.89℃
140℉ | 60.00℃
160℉ | 71.11℃
180℉ | 82.22℃
200℉ | 93.33℃
220℉ | 104.44℃
240℉ | 115.56℃
260℉ | 126.67℃
280℉ | 137.78℃
300℉ | 148.89℃
可以看出,随着华氏温度的增加,摄氏温度逐渐升高。当华氏温度为0℉时,摄氏温度为-17.78℃,随着华氏温度每升高20℉,对应的摄氏温度约升高11.11℃。因此,对于温度的转换,我们必须准确地掌握华氏和摄氏温度的转换公式,以便在需要的时候,进行快速而准确的计算。
### 回答3:
华氏温度和摄氏温度是常见的两种温度计量单位,在不同的场合下使用不同的温度计来检测温度。而在不同温度单位之间转换时,需要使用特定的转换公式。华氏和摄氏温度的转换公式为 c = 5/9 x (f-32),其中f表示华氏温度,c表示摄氏温度。
在华氏0℉~300℉的范围内,每隔20℉输出一个华氏温度对应的摄氏温度值可以使用循环来实现。具体代码如下:
for f in range(0, 301, 20):
c = 5/9 * (f-32)
print("华氏{}度对应的摄氏温度为{}度".format(f, c))
在代码中,使用for循环遍历华氏0℉~300℉的范围,步长为20。在循环内部,根据转换公式计算出对应的摄氏温度值,并使用print函数输出。在输出中使用.format()方法将华氏温度和对应的摄氏温度进行格式化处理,更加易于阅读。
因此,华氏0℉~300℉,每隔20℉输出一个华氏温度对应的摄氏温度值是可以很方便地使用Python代码实现的。